Across its 43.8 km², Upper Mangrove is highly constrained by planning overlays. Very little of the suburb carries a mapped flood overlay, and 100% is flagged bushfire-prone. There are 8 heritage-listed sites on record, and the dominant land-use zone is Forestry. The median lot measures about 197,968 m² across 62 parcels. These figures are suburb-wide - the overlays that actually apply to a given lot can differ block to block, which is what a property-level check tells you.

Is Upper Mangrove flood-prone?
Very little of Upper Mangrove carries a mapped flood overlay. Flood overlays vary block to block, so whether a particular lot is affected needs a property-level check.
Is Upper Mangrove bushfire-prone?
Yes - around 100% of Upper Mangrove is mapped as bushfire-prone, compared with a Central Coast average of 69%. A bushfire-prone designation can trigger additional building requirements, so check the specific address.
What is the zoning in Upper Mangrove?
The dominant planning zone in Upper Mangrove is Forestry, though the suburb also includes National Parks and Nature Reserves and Environmental Conservation. Zoning sets what you can build and do on a site, and can differ lot by lot.
Does Upper Mangrove have heritage-listed places?
Upper Mangrove has 8 heritage-listed places on record. Heritage listing affects what you can alter or demolish, so confirm whether a specific property is listed or near a heritage place.
What is the typical lot size in Upper Mangrove?
Across 62 surveyed parcels in Upper Mangrove, the median lot size is about 197,968 m². There are also 2 registered easements mapped in the suburb - an easement can restrict where you can build, so always check the title and overlays for the specific lot.
